Housing is the foundation for opportunity. But throughout United States history, housing policy and practices have perpetuated racism and segregation. From federal laws that authorized redlining to local policies that permitting restrictive covenants and exclusive zoning codes, biased housing policy has made a lasting effect on our society.
HOME of VA is committed to ensuring equal access to housing opportunities for all. We believe that public policy is crucial to achieving this goal — working to shape policy that will combat housing inequality and dismantle a long history of discrimination that endures today.
The Virginia Fair Housing Law prohibits housing discrimination based on race, color, religion, national origin, sex, elderliness, familial status, source of funds, sexual orientation, gender identity, military status, and disability. This landmark legislation, which HOME of VA has successfully worked to expand over the years, underpins our mission. At the General Assembly and in localities around the Commonwealth, we advocate to maintain and expand upon these protections.
